What Is A Step Up A Step Down Transformer Definition A step down transformer has a primary and secondary winding wound on the iron core. the step up & step down transformer function on the principle of magnetic induction between the coils. You can identify a step up or step down transformer by checking the voltage levels, winding turns ratio, and label information. a step up transformer increases voltage, while a step down transformer reduces it. Step up transformers are where the output or secondary voltage is greater than the input or primary voltage. whereas, in step down transformers, the secondary or output voltage is less than the primary. A step up transformer increases voltage, making it ideal for transmitting power over long distances, while a step down transformer decreases voltage, ensuring electricity is safe for use in homes and businesses. What is step up and step down transformer? a step up transformer is a device which makes long distance transmission of electrical energy economically efficient; it converts low voltage ac into high voltage ac, which decreases the loss of energy during transmission.
